The challenges and specificities of the watchmaking & jewelry industry
Management of Precious Materials Weight Accounts
Track the movements of your precious metals — gold, silver, platinum, alloys — to the gram with integrated metal accounting. Value your stocks in real time according to market prices, control processing losses, and automatically integrate these costs into your cost calculations to protect your margins.
Traceability & Quality
Ensure complete and seamless traceability of each component, batch, and serial number, from raw material to finished product delivery. Document every production step, manage non-conformities, and prepare your quality inspections with the rigor demanded by a sector where even the slightest failure impacts the brand’s reputation.
Production Management & Complex Bill of Materials
Manage manufacturing orders incorporating multi-level technical bills of materials, detailed operational ranges, and varied production modes — mass production, piece production, or limited edition. Plan your capacities, optimize your lead times, and handle product customization without overburdening your teams.
Specialized Subcontracting
Centralize the management of your entire network of partners — turning, crimping, polishing, decoration, assembly — with real-time visibility into costs, deadlines, and the progress of outsourced operations. Coordinate complex multi-actor chains without ever losing control.
Watch After-Sales Service
Manage repairs, guarantees, and returns with dedicated after-sales nomenclatures and a complete history for each piece. Provide your customers with an after-sales experience that meets the high standards of your brand, while keeping refurbishment costs under control.
International Expansion & Multi-Entity Management
Deploy a consistent core ERP model across all your subsidiaries and markets, consolidate your financial reporting in real-time, and standardize your processes at a group level. From Europe to Asia, every new market becomes an opportunity without administrative overload.

Our ERP solutions for watchmaking and jewelry have been enhanced in collaboration with our clients in the sector to cover the most critical functions of your profession, available in Cloud and On-Premise:
- Metal accounting and weight account management with real-time valuation based on market rates
- Complete traceability by serial and batch number, from raw material to finished product
- Management of multi-level bill of materials and complex operational ranges
- Integrated management of subcontracting: costs, deadlines, quantities, and real-time progress status
- Watchmaker after-sales service management: repairs, warranties, part history, and return tracking
- Cost calculation incorporating precious materials, operations, and subcontracting
- Multi-site, multi-company, and multi-currency management for internationally oriented groups
